Abstract VerDate Aug<31>2005 15:14 Jul 23, 2008 Jkt 214001 The Migratory Bird Treaty Act (16 U.S.C. 703-712) and Fish and Wildlife Act of 1956 (16 U.S.C. 742a - 754j-2) designate the Department of the Interior as the primary agency responsible for (1) wise management of migratory bird populations frequenting the United States and (2) setting hunting regulations that allow for the well-being of migratory bird populations. These responsibilities dictate that we gather accurate data on various characteristics of migratory bird populations. The Mourning Dove Call Count Survey is an essential part of the migratory bird management program. The survey is a cooperative effort between the Service and State wildlife agencies and local and tribal biologists. Each spring, State, Service, local, and tribal biologists conduct the survey to provide the necessary data to determine the population status of the mourning dove. If this survey were not conducted, we would not be able to determine the population status of mourning doves prior to setting regulations. The Service and the States use the survey results to: (1) develop annual regulations for hunting mourning doves, (2) plan and evaluate dove management programs, and (3) provide specific information necessary for dove research.
